What percentage of people use an interior designer?
The fourth annual Houzz and Home survey found that millennial homeowners in the U. S. were “just as likely” to renovate as other age groups in 2014. Despite only one in 10 homeowners being aged 25 to 34, over half renovated last year, and were more decorated and made minor repairs compared to the 55-plus homeowners surveyed. Houzz’s principal economist, Nino Sitchinava, explained that millennial homeowners are just as active in renovating and decorating as older generations. The survey also revealed that millennial views on resale value, energy efficiency, and healthy homes are similar to those of older generations.

Will AI replace interior designers?
AI has the potential to improve the ID process, but it is unlikely to replace human interior designers entirely. Is interior design a successful career?
Interior design is a lucrative career that allows individuals to shape the way we experience and interact with spaces. Interior designers are architectural alchemists who blend aesthetics with functionality, ensuring a harmonious and efficient layout. Their responsibilities include space planning, conceptualization, material selection, collaboration, visualization, project management, staying informed, problem-solving, client consultation, and compliance with codes and regulations.
Space planning involves meticulous analysis of available space, optimizing functionality and flow by determining the strategic placement of furniture, fixtures, and other elements. Conceptualization involves developing creative concepts based on client preferences, project goals, and spatial functionality, selecting color schemes, materials, and themes that align with the client’s vision and the intended purpose of the space. Material selection involves selecting materials such as flooring, wall coverings, furniture, and accessories to achieve the desired look and feel.
Collaboration is essential for successful implementation of the design vision, as interior designers collaborate closely with architects, contractors, and other professionals involved in construction or renovation projects. Visualization uses tools like sketches, renderings, and computer-aided design (CAD) software to present visual representations of their ideas. Project management involves overseeing various aspects including budgeting, scheduling, and coordination with contractors and vendors.
In a dynamic industry, designers must stay abreast of evolving trends, materials, and technologies to offer contemporary and relevant design solutions. Problem-solving involves finding creative solutions to challenges, while client consultation helps gather information about clients’ tastes, budget, and functional requirements. Compliance with building codes, safety regulations, and accessibility standards is crucial for the well-being of occupants and the success of the project.
